Charlie and the Chocolate Factory







Running Time: 1 hr. 46 min.
Release Date: July 15th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Warner Bros.
Starring: Johnny Depp, Freddie Highmore, David Kelly, AnnaSophia Robb, Helena Bonham Carter
Directed by: Tim Burton
Distributor: Warner Bros.



What's The Story?
There are five golden tickets hidden in candy bars scattered around the world. Anyone who finds one is invited to meet the strange and mysterious chocolatier Willy Wonka and join him on a tour of his wondrous factory. For Charlie Bucket, a lonely kid from a poor family, finding a ticket could be the opportunity of a lifetime.

Three Good Reasons
• It's the fourth collaboration between director Tim Burton and star Johnny Depp, who always bring out the best (and weirdest) in each other.
• Screenwriter John August directly adapted the Roald Dahl novel. He didn't see the 1971 original film until after he was finished.
• Depp recommended Freddie Highmore for the role of Charlie after working with the young actor in "Finding Neverland."


Bet You Didn't Know
The fifth movie for Tim Burton and Johnny Depp -- the stop-motion animated "Tim Burton's Corpse Bride" -- will hit theaters this September.

Fantastic Four






Running Time: 2 hrs. 03 min.
Release Date: July 8th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Twentieth Century Fox
Starring: Ioan Gruffudd, Jessica Alba, Michael Chiklis, Chris Evans, Julian McMahon
Directed by: Tim Story
Distributor: Twentieth Century Fox



What's The Story
Cosmic radiation turns four scientists into a family of superheroes: Reed Richards/Mr. Fantastic, who can elongate his body; Susan Storm/Invisible Woman, who can become transparent and create force fields; Johnny Storm/Human Torch, who can control fire and fly; and Ben Grimm/The Thing, a misshapen monster with superhuman strength. Together they battle the evil Doctor Doom.

Three Good Reasons
• Flame on! The Fantastic Four are the first superheroes Stan Lee and Jack Kirby created with Marvel Comics, so it's time they got their movie.
• Michael Chiklis is a great choice to play the old-school brawler, Ben Grimm - a guy who still uses words like "clobber."
• An effects-laden action film with a bunch of superheroes running around? This is what summer's all about.


Bet You Didn't Know
In 1978, there was an animated Fantastic Four TV show, but NBC replaced the Human Torch with a happy, floating little robot friend named H.E.R.B.I.E. because they feared dangerous "imitatable behavior."

Stealth






Release Date: July 29th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Columbia Pictures
Starring: Josh Lucas, Jessica Biel, Jamie Foxx, Joe Morton, Richard Roxburgh
Directed by: Rob Cohen
Distributor: Columbia Pictures



What's The Story?
Three hot-shot Navy pilots reluctantly participate in the development of a high-tech unmanned combat plane. When a freak accident causes the plane's artificial intelligence to "wake up," the human pilots have to take down the deadliest opponent they've ever faced.

Three Good Reasons
• Jamie Foxx makes for a great fast-talking hero.
• Jessica Biel can make even a Navy flight suit hot.
• It should be as action-packed as director Rob Cohen's previous films "XXX" and "The Fast and the Furious."


Bet You Didn't Know
"Stealth" screenwriter W.D. Richter directed the cult favorite "The Adventures of Buckaroo Banzai Across the 8th Dimension."

Dark Water






Release Date: July 8th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: PG-13 for mature thematic material, frightening sequences, disturbing images and brief language.
Distributor: Touchstone Pictures
Starring: Jennifer Connelly, John C. Reilly, Tim Roth, Dougray Scott, Pete Postlethwaite
Directed by: Walter Salles
Distributor: Touchstone Pictures



What's The Story?
Dahlia Williams is starting a new life with her daughter when her dilapidated apartment seems to take on a life of its own. Mysterious noises, persistent leaks of dark water, and strange happenings cause her imagination to run wild, leaving her to wonder who is behind the endless mind games.

Three Good Reasons
• What happens when the Brazilian director of "The Motorcycle Diaries" remakes a Japanese horror film? Who knows? But it sounds intriguing.
• The original film sprang from the same mind that gave birth to "The Ring."
• Jennifer Connelly. And if you think she's just another pretty face, she's got a friend named Oscar she'd like you to meet.


Bet You Didn't Know
The title of the original Japanese novel and film was "Honogurai Mizu No Soko Kara," which directly translates to "From the gloomy waters."

The Island






Release Date: July 22nd,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Dreamworks SKG
Starring: Ewan McGregor, Scarlett Johansson, Djimon Hounsou, Sean Bean, Steve Buscemi
Directed by: Michael Bay
Distributor: Dreamworks SKG



What's The Story?
In an underground facility in the not-too-distant future, Lincoln Six-Echo is one of the many inhabitants hoping for a ticket to "The Island" -- what they're told is the last pristine place on the planet. When he learns that he is really a clone being raised for organ harvesting, he and a female captive try to escape their fate.

Three Good Reasons
• Ewan McGregor and Scarlett Johansson: two hotties, no waiting.
• Four of the best supporting actors around: Djimon Hounsou, Sean Bean, Michael Clark Duncan, and Steve Buscemi.
• It's directed by maestro of mayhem Michael Bay, so you know stuff's gonna 'splode.


Bet You Didn't Know
Screenwriters Alex Kurtzman and Roberto Orci started out writing TV's "Hercules: The Legendary Journeys," and then graduated to ABC's "Alias." Upcoming projects for the duo include "Legend of Zorro" this fall and "Mission: Impossible 3" in '06.

Wedding Crashers






Release Date: July 15th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: New Line Cinema
Starring: Owen Wilson, Vince Vaughn, Rachel McAdams, Christopher Walken, Will Ferrell
Directed by: David Dobkin
Distributor: New Line Cinema



What's The Story?
Womanizing bachelor buddies John and Jeremy crash wedding receptions to pick up vulnerable single women, always following their detailed "rules" to maximize their effectiveness. But when one of them falls for the engaged daughter of a prominent politician, the rules go out the window as he tries to win her over.

Three Good Reasons
• It's the first partnering of Owen Wilson and Vince Vaughn, two of the most charismatic funnymen around.
• The lovely Rachel McAdams is the girl who catches Wilson's eye, and Christopher Walken is her no-nonsense dad.
• It wouldn't be a comedy without another insane cameo from Will Ferrell.


Bet You Didn't Know
Senator John McCain and political consultant James Carville cameo in a scene with Christopher Walken.

The Brothers Grimm







Release Date: July 29th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: PG-13 for violence, frightening sequences and brief suggestive material.
Distributor: Dimension Films
Starring: Matt Damon, Heath Ledger, Monica Bellucci, Jonathan Price, Lena Headey
Directed by: Terry Gilliam
Distributor: Dimension Films



What's The Story?
Before they were writers, Jake and Will Grimm were con men, using their knowledge of folktales to scam villages to pay them for protection from "enchanted" creatures. Their scheme catches up with them, though, when the French government enlists them to track down a real evil sorceress who's been kidnapping young women.

Three Good Reasons
• Visionary director Terry Gilliam brings his eye for the fantastic to the world of fairy tales.
• Who better to play a sultry yet scary witch than Italian seductress Monica Bellucci?
• It's written by Ehren Kruger, the screenwriter of fright-fests like "The Ring" and the upcoming "The Skeleton Key."


Bet You Didn't Know
Gilliam's first solo film, "Jabberwocky," was also a period piece about fantastic creatures. The director had to threaten legal action against some distributors who tried to market the film as another Monty Python movie.

Hustle & Flow






Running Time: 1 hr. 54 min.
Release Date: July 13th, 2005 (NY/LA)
MPAA Rating: R for sex and drug content, pervasive language and some violence.
Distributor: Paramount Classics
Starring: Terrence Dashon Howard, DJ Qualls, Ludacris, Anthony Anderson, Taryn Manning
Directed by: Craig Brewer
Distributor: Paramount Classics



What's The Story?
Djay is a blue-collar pimp suffering an early midlife crisis. With a lifetime of hard experiences and observations, he yearns to share his stories and change his ways on his way to becoming a rap star. But even with a little gospel inspiration and some help from his friends, he finds that the road to fame and respect is neither easy nor predictable.

Three Good Reasons
• It's a breakout role for Terrence Dashon Howard, who's been a reliable supporting player for over a decade.
• Producer John Singleton returns with some of his "Boyz in the Hood" caliber filmmaking magic.
• The crunkity Dirty South hip-hop beats are hot, and Howard really can rap.


Bet You Didn't Know
In a record-setting deal, Paramount Pictures/MTV Films bought the distribution rights for "Hustle & Flow" for $9 million at the 2005 Sundance Film Festival.

The Devil's Rejects






Release Date: July 22nd,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: R for sadistic violence, strong sexual content, language and drug use.
Distributor: Lions Gate Films
Starring: Sid Haig, Bill Moseley, Sheri Moon Zombie, Matthew McGrory, William Forsythe
Directed by: Rob Zombie
Distributor: Lions Gate Films



What's The Story?
After a bloody showdown at their home, the murderous Firefly family goes on the lam. With their story all over the news, they continue their killing spree, while Sheriff John Wydell, hell-bent on avenging his brother's murder, tracks them down for one last horrifying confrontation.

Three Good Reasons
• It's rock-star-turned-director Rob Zombie's follow-up to his debut film, "House of 1000 Corpses."
• You'll get gore and violence, but you'll also get humor and tenderness and Sheri Moon Zombie... then more gore and violence.
• There's lots of rock 'n roll, and you'll like it.


Bet You Didn't Know
Many of the names of the characters -- Captain Spaulding, Otis Driftwood, and Rufus Firefly -- are from Groucho Marx characters.

The Bad News Bears







Release Date: June 10th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Paramount Pictures
Starring: Billy Bob Thornton, Greg Kinnear, Marcia Gay Harden, Timmy Deters, Sammi Kane Kraft
Directed by: Richard Linklater
Distributor: Paramount Pictures



What's The Story?
In this remake of the 1976 comedy of bad manners, a drunken, disheveled, and disgruntled former minor-league player finds himself coaching a Little League team of misfits.

Three Good Reasons
• Versatile director Richard Linklater ("Dazed and Confused," "Before Sunrise," "School of Rock") tries his hand at a remake.
• After his hilarious turn as a boozy St. Nick in "Bad Santa," Billy Bob Thornton should knock it out of the park as gruff Coach Buttermaker.
• A team full of wild and raucous kids, led by newcomer Sammi Kraft as the smart-mouthed pitcher (originally played by Tatum O'Neal).


Bet You Didn't Know
Glenn Ficarra and John Requa, the screenwriters responsible for the foul language and shameful behavior in "Bad Santa," penned the script.

Must Love Dogs






Release Date: July 29th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Warner Bros. Pictures
Starring: Diane Lane, John Cusack, Dermot Mulroney, Christopher Plummer, Stockard Channing
Directed by: Gary David Goldberg
Distributor: Warner Bros. Pictures



What's The Story?
Sarah Hurlihy is a divorced preschool teacher who's sworn off dating after a bad breakup. Her Irish family pushes her back into the dating scene by placing an online personal ad requiring that anyone answering it "must love dogs," despite the fact that Sarah doesn't own a dog. When someone intriguing finally responds to the ad, Sarah decides to borrow Mother Theresa, her brother's dog, and plunge in.

Three Good Reasons
• Diane Lane's gets the chance to really carry a film after her Oscar nomination for "Unfaithful."
• When John Cusack makes a romantic comedy, you can be pretty sure it's gonna be interesting, even for the guys.
• The great Christopher Plummer plays Sarah's Irish father, who's also re-entering the dating realm and has a randier experience with it.


Bet You Didn't Know
In the book, Mother Theresa is a St. Bernard, not a Newfoundland as in the movie. Author Claire Cook was skeptical about the change but says she's withholding judgment because she never met a "Newfie" she didn't like.

Sky High







Release Date: July 29th, 2005 (wide)
MPAA Rating: Not Rated.
Distributor: Walt Disney Pictures
Starring: Michael Angarano, Kelly Preston, Kurt Russell, Lynda Carter, Danielle Panabaker
Directed by: Mike Mitchell
Distributor: Walt Disney Pictures



What's The Story?
When you're the son of the world's most legendary superheroes, The Commander and Jetstream, there's only one place for you -- Sky High, an elite high school for the superhuman. The problem is that Will Stronghold has no superpowers of his own and, worst of all, is relegated to being a "Sidekick."

Three Good Reasons
• Take the X-Men's school for mutants, mix in the angst of "Smallville," add the comedy of "The Incredibles," and you'll get this.
• Kurt Russell should have been a superhero a lot sooner.
• "Wonder Woman" Lynda Carter plays the school principal, and Bruce Campbell is the obnoxious gym teacher.


Bet You Didn't Know
Disney has plans to turn this into a television series on the Disney Channel. Well, OK, maybe you could've guessed that.
